The core members of HYBE who led the global super group BTS to success are taking on a new challenge.
LETOPIA SALON was recently established by HYBE‘s CEO Bang Woo-jung, CCO (Chief Creative Officer) Kim Soo-rin, and COO (Chief Operating Officer) Park Jun-su. They plan to hold a global audition next month to introduce a new idol group.
LETOPIA SALON symbolizes a utopia realized in the real world. Under the vision of ‘Make Dreams Real’, it contains the aspiration to make the passion for popular art go beyond dreams and become a real experience.
LETOPIA SALON is an entertainment company that encompasses artist management and content production, and is currently producing BTS Jin’s YouTube entertainment content ‘Run Seok Jin’.
As a collection of content experts who are differentiated from existing entertainment companies, it is expected to bring about new innovation to the K-pop market.
CEO Bang Woo-jung said, “Letopia Salon aims to create an experience that does not exist in the world with vibrant content. Our first project will be to introduce a boy group that will lead the K-pop market, and we will begin full-scale team formation by starting large-scale global auditions in March.”
CEO Bang Woo-jung, who joined Big Hit Entertainment in 2010, was the former Creative Studio Leader of HYBE Media Studio, where he oversaw the production of various content for HYBE Music Group’s major artists until September of last year.
In particular, he is the person who led fan communication using social media and digital platforms, which is one of the factors behind BTS’s success, and is also the creator of planned, self-produced content, aka ‘Jacon’, which is currently considered the basic grammar for K-pop idols.
His representative works include ‘Run BTS’, ‘In the SOOP’, etc., and these works were recognized for their artistry to the point that they were aired on broadcast stations such as Mnet and JTBC.
CCO Kim Soo-rin is the former VP of Hive Labels Japan. After joining Big Hit Entertainment in 2011, she led fan content for BTS, TXT, and Enhypen.
She was in charge of the visual directing of the artists‘ fan meetings, season greetings, and photo books, and is evaluated as someone who broadened the scope of fan experiences by planning ‘FESTA’, an event commemorating BTS’s debut. After moving to the Japanese corporation, he took charge of local trainee casting and branding.
COO Park Jun-su is from HYBE original content studio SP (Senior Professional) and is famous for directing all of BTS‘s variety shows, reality shows, documentaries, and movies, such as ‘Run BTS’, ‘Bon Voyage’, and ‘Burn The Stage’.
He also directed SEVENTEEN’s ‘In the SOOP’, ‘In the SOOP: Friendship Trip’ starring Park Seo-joon, Peakboy, Choi Woo-shik, Park Hyung-sik, and BTS‘s V, and ‘Backstage: TXT x ENHYPEN Documentary‘.
